EHDD | San Francisco
San Francisco-based EHDD is a national leader in design, having developed an award winning design practice integrating architecture, planning, technology and sustainability. Founded in 1946 by Joseph Esherick, EHDD Architecture is internationally renowned for its institutional projects including libraries, museums and most notably the Monterey Bay Aquarium. EHDD is devoted to sustainability, and has received numerous design awards and honors, including the Firm of the Year and Gold Medal Awards from the National American Institute of Architects and the Architectural Firm Award from the AIA California Council.
